i5-8250U is better than i5-5200U.

For the following aspects:

Architecture and process:

  1. i5-8250U SR3LA is based on the Kaby Lake Refresh architecture and adopts a 14-nanometer process. While i5-5200U is based on the Broadwell architecture, and the process is relatively old. The advanced architecture and process make i5-8250U more excellent in energy consumption control and performance performance.
  2. For example, under the same heat dissipation conditions, i5-8250U can maintain a lower temperature and a higher performance output.
    Core and thread count:
  3. i5-8250U is quad-core eight-thread, while i5-5200U is dual-core four-thread. More cores and threads mean that i5-8250U has a significant advantage in multitasking processing ability.
  4. For example, when running multiple large programs or performing multitasking operations simultaneously, i5-8250U can complete tasks more quickly and reduce stuttering.
    Frequency:
  5. The base frequency and maximum turbo frequency of i5-8250U are relatively higher, which makes it have better performance in both single-thread and multi-thread performance.
  6. For example, when processing a single large software or game, a higher frequency can bring a more smooth experience.
    Performance performance:
  7. In the comprehensive performance test, the score of i5-8250U is usually significantly higher than that of i5-5200U. Whether it is CPU computing power, graphics processing ability or memory bandwidth, etc., there is a large improvement.

 

To sum up, if choosing between i5-5200U and i5-8250U, i5-8250U is a better choice and can provide better performance and usage experience.
